It offers a data transfer performance of up to 1000 Mbit/s. It is designed to operate with an input voltage of 24 V and an input current of 0.5 A, with a maximum power consumption of 11 W. It is designed to be mounted on a pole and is white in color. The antenna is internal, with dimensions of width of 140 mm, depth of 1404 mm and height of 44 mm. Manufactured by Ubiquiti with reference GBE.

Gbps

Gbps (Gigabits per second) is a unit of data transfer rate equal to one billion bits per second.

In telecommunications and network engineering, Gbps defines the bandwidth capacity of fiber optic infrastructures (FTTH) and core backbones. This metric quantifies the effective throughput of a communication channel, enabling massive packet transfer without link saturation. Implementation at the physical layer requires high-speed interfaces like Gigabit Ethernet to manage digital signaling and ensure data flow integrity across the network nodes.

UnitTechnical Equivalence
1 Gbps (bits)1,000,000,000 b/s
1 Gbps (Megabits)1,000 Mb/s

Bandwidth Management and Network Capacity

A 1 Gbps link allows for efficient service segmentation via VLANs and traffic prioritization through QoS, supporting data-intensive real-time protocols without encountering bottlenecks at the hardware level.
